- Permanent Full Time- We are looking for an **Investment Compliance Analyst**.- The Investment Compliance Analyst, as a member of Investment Compliance team, provides 2nd line independent oversight of regulatory risk management framework within the Investment Division, providing expert advice and guidance to assist our business in meeting its regulatory obligation. Investment Compliance has oversight over the Investment Division’s broad spectrum of assets and liabilities with a variety of activities that include:
- Bond Investments (Public & Private)
- Equity Investments (Public & Private)
- Mortgage Investments (Residential & Commercial)
- Asset Liability Management (Par and Non-Par Liabilities)
- GWL Realty Advisors (Canadian and U.S. Real Estate)

**What you will do**:

- Responsible for equity aggregation for Canada and Europe Operations - Prepare and analyze results of the daily, monthly and quarterly reports to ensure compliance with Canadian and International Security Legislation.
- Responsible for the preparation, reconciliation and analysis of the quarterly reports including reports for the Management Investment Review Committee and the Investment Committee of the Board. This includes monitoring investment activities to ensure compliance with Canadian Investment Policy.
- Review and assess Canadian Investment strategies (e.g. alternative investments).
- Review and monitor risks (e.g. compliance, operational, privacy, IS) for significant initiatives and assess mitigation plans.
- Perform second line compliance monitoring of processes, reports or tools to enable Investment Compliance to effectively oversee investment activities within the Investment Division.
- Conduct ongoing reviews of existing policies against current regulations to maintain mapping to ensure all relevant regulations are incorporated into management policies and processes; participate in any policy development as required.
- Assess new and emerging regulations and create informative summaries describing implications for distribution to Investment Division leadership.
- Monitor and manage Corporate Compliance Assessment testing, findings and action plans.
- Monitor and manage Internal Audit testing, findings and management action plans.
- Participate in projects and other duties as assigned.
